Here is a BIG tip. First, get your m98c as a package. That should include gun, mask (try to get a thermal mask, and not the 32* Head Case. Ask if you can exchange it for another mask.) It should have a hopper, oil, barrel plug, sqeegie, some paintballs, and maybe a harness. It will be MUCH cheaper that way. Play with it stock a few times, and figure out what you need. Before I got my tippy, I made a list of what I wanted. That list changed ALOT after I played with it only the first time. Just get your neccessities and play. Then get your upgrades. You may find you need a stock, or a rocket cock, or nitro. First play with it, then decide. I thought I knew alot of paintball before I went playing for my first time with my own gun over a year ago. I found out that I was dead wrong. Advice helps, but the only way to learn is with experience.
I cannot stress enough to get your m98c as a package. Since it is one of the most popular beginner guns, everywhere offers it. Just search around for the package you like most for the best price you can find. Never purchase it all seperately.
